ARE CATALOGS DEAD?
Why Direct Mail Catalogs Still Drive Sales
In the age of digital marketing, it may seem like catalogs are a thing of the past. But
that couldn’t be further from the truth. Catalogs remain one of the most effective direct
marketing tools available, and they're especially well-suited for direct mail.
General Benefits
Here are just a few of the reasons why catalogs are such an important direct mail marketing tool:
- They're tangible. Catalogs are physical objects that people can hold in their hands and browse at their own pace. This makes them more engaging and memorable than other digital marketing channels like email and social media.
- They're visually appealing. Catalogs are typically well-designed and feature high-quality photography, which helps showcase products in the best possible light and capture consumers' attention.
- They're informative. Catalogs provide detailed product information, including features, specifications, and pricing. This makes it easy for consumers to compare products and make informed purchasing decisions.
- They're personalized. Catalogs can be personalized to target specific consumers or demographics, making them more relevant and effective than generic marketing messages.
- They're measurable. Catalogs can be tracked to measure their effectiveness regarding response rates, sales, and other key metrics. This helps businesses to optimize their marketing campaigns over time.
Specific Benefits
In addition to these general benefits, catalogs offer several specific advantages for direct mail campaigns. For example, catalogs can be used to:
- Target high-value customers. Catalogs can be mailed to a targeted list of customers with a proven history of purchasing from the business. This helps to ensure that the catalogs are being seen by the people who are most likely to be interested in the products.
- Drive traffic to the website. Catalogs can be used to promote the business's website and encourage customers to visit it to learn more about products and make purchases.
- Generate leads. Catalogs can be used to collect leads from potential customers. This information can then be used to follow up with these leads and nurture them into paying customers.
- Increase brand awareness. Catalogs can be used to build brand awareness and promote the business's brand identity. This can help to set the business apart from its competitors and attract new customers.
Overall, catalogs are a powerful direct marketing tool that can be used to achieve a variety of business goals. When used effectively, catalogs can help businesses to target high-value customers, drive traffic to their website, generate leads, and increase brand awareness.
Tips
Here are some tips for creating effective direct mail catalog campaigns:
PERSONALIZE YOUR CATALOGS
Segment your customer list and send different catalogs to different groups of customers based on their interests and purchase history.
USE HIGH-QUALITY PHOTOGRAPHY
Your catalog images should be sharp, clear, and visually appealing.
WRITE INFORMATIVE PRODUCT DESCRIPTIONS
Your product descriptions should be detailed and informative, but they should also be engaging and persuasive.
INCLUDE A CALL TO ACTION
Tell your customers what you want them to do, whether it’s visiting your website, making a purchase, or signing up for your email list.
TRACK YOUR RESULTS
Track your catalog campaigns to measure their effectiveness and make adjustments as needed.
By following these tips, you can create direct mail catalog campaigns that will help you achieve your business goals.
